Chapter 5: Using Your Protector Perchloric Acid Fume Hood

Operating the A-Style
Combination Sash

Optional hood models have additional energy saving
sashes called A-Style combination sashes in place of
vertical-rising sashes. These combination sashes allow
the operator to use the hood with sashes either half open
horizontally or vertically to conserve energy. The
horizontal sashes are used in normal operating mode.
Optional sets of sash stops can be installed to prevent
raising the vertical sash above the half-open and fully-
closed positions unless manually defeated by the
operator. The airflow requirements are sized for the
50% open sash condition.

Operating the Blower

Your Protector Perchloric Acid Fume Hood utilizes a
remote style blower, which can be activated by turning
the blower switch to “ON.” You can validate the hood
performance by watching smoke drawn into the hood
face opening.

Operating the Lights

Your Protector Perchloric Acid Fume Hood utilizes a
factory-wired fluorescent light to illuminate the hood
interior. Simply turn the light switch to “ON” to
operate.

Operating the Washdown
Control Valve

Your Protector Perchloric Acid Fume Hood has a
washdown control valve located on the upper left-hand
side that controls water to the washdown spray nozzles.
The nozzles are located behind the hood baffle and will
washdown areas in the hood, which are unaccessible
without removing the baffle. The washdown control
system can also be set up to control the washdown rings
